Tasks

As Director of QA/QC, you will lead and manage the development of a national quality program that reflects industry-leading standards and prioritizes continuous improvement. This role calls for deep expertise in Building Science, along with active involvement in industry organizations and leadership roles. You’ll be instrumental in building scalable QA/QC strategies across diverse market sectors, supporting the company’s ambitious growth and commitment to excellence. -Provide expert guidance on building envelope systems, including moisture control, thermal performance, and fire/sound-rated assemblies. -Support the development of enterprise-wide quality dashboards and insights to drive continuous improvement. -Contribute to internal training and industry education by authoring best practices and technical content. -Oversee field inspections and consulting services to ensure compliance with national and local codes. -Create field inspection protocols focused on operational excellence and aligned with project-specific contract documents. -Leads national QA/QC programs with a focus on code compliance, operational excellence, and continuous improvement. -Lead and mentor a multi-disciplinary team of Quality Program Managers and Inspectors across multiple regions. -Develop and implement Envelope Commissioning (Cx) programs, inspection protocols, and mock-up testing procedures. -Conduct expert-level field investigations and reporting to support internal analysis and dispute resolution. -Holds leadership roles in industry organizations and contributes to internal training and best practices development.

What You Bring

-Proficient in thermal imaging, water and concrete testing, and forensic analysis. -15 + years of proven leadership in QA/QC, specializing in building envelope systems and construction quality management. -ASQ Certified Construction Quality Manager, IIBEC Registered Roof Observer (RRO), EIMA/AWCI Certified EIFS Professional, International Firestop Council Special Inspector, OSHA 30-Hour Construction Safety, Procore Certified (Quality & Safety). -Active member of ASTM, ASQ, IIBEC, ABA, ICC, and the Air Barrier Association of America.

The Company

About Willmeng Construction, Inc.

-The firm grew from a local Phoenix builder into one of the Southwest’s largest general contractors. -Operates through early-stage planning and preconstruction, thinking like owners to guide delivery from concept to completion. -Its portfolio spans ground-up and tenant-improvement work in commercial, industrial, municipal, aviation, healthcare, education, and hospitality sectors. -Notable projects include the $180 million CapRock West 202 logistics center, additions to Northrop Grumman facilities, and the Banner Sports Medicine Center. -Recognized as ENR Southwest Contractor of the Year. -Distinctive for its proactive problem‑solving approach on site, cloud‑based communication tools, and a zero‑accident safety record.
